Eugene Lee Advances To Round Of 16 At NCAA Singles Championship; Earns All-American Status

Junior rallied for First Round victory Saturday morning

Chattanooga, TN – Vassar College junior Eugene Lee (Chico, CA) won his First Round decision in three sets on Saturday at the NCAA Division III Singles Championship and in the process earned All-American status for the Brewers. Lee became the first Brewer to win at match at the singles championship since Andrew Guzick won two matches in 2011.
 
After falling behind by a set in the opener against Tufts' Alex Ganchev, Lee rallied to go the distance and earn a hard fought 4-6, 6-4, 6-3 victory, his 15th singles victory of the spring. Lee went on to battle Alexander Ekstrand from the University of Chicago, who upset the number four seed in the draw, in the Round of 16, battling in a 1-6, 4-6 defeat.
 
Lee, a First Tean All-Liberty League selection in singles, closes out a standout junior season with a 19-9 overall record covering the season's two semesters.
